Analyzing Nelly Corda's Swing
To illustrate the GOAT delivery position, let’s take a closer look at Nelly Corda, a standout player known for her exceptional swing mechanics. As she transitions into her delivery position, several key characteristics stand out:
- External Rotation of the Left Arm: In the delivery position, Corda's left arm exhibits external rotation, which is crucial for maintaining proper alignment and generating power.
- Right Elbow Position: Notice how her right elbow is positioned close to her body, allowing for a more compact swing path, which enhances control and accuracy.
- Alignment of the Glove Logo: The logo on her glove points straight at the camera, indicating a direct line to the target. This alignment is a common trait among elite players, ensuring that the clubface is properly oriented at impact.
Key Characteristics of the GOAT Delivery Position
When analyzing the delivery position, here are critical aspects to focus on:
- Left Elbow Orientation: In the GOAT delivery position, the left elbow typically points down the target line. This alignment helps maintain a consistent swing path and promotes a square clubface at impact.
- Protracted Left Shoulder: The left shoulder should be protracted, meaning it is extended away from the body. This positioning allows for a more dynamic turn and helps in generating greater swing speed.
- Right Palm Orientation: The right palm should also face straight at the camera, which reinforces the connection between the arms and the body, ensuring a synchronized movement during the swing.
Applying the GOAT Delivery Position to Your Game
To incorporate the GOAT delivery position into your own swing, practice the following drills:
- Mirror Drill: Using a mirror, check your arm and shoulder positions during the takeaway and downswing to ensure they match the characteristics of elite players.
- Video Analysis: Record your swing and compare it with the delivery positions of top players. This can help you identify areas for improvement.
